Billionaire and ex-parliamentary member Clive Palmer has announced to build a replica of the legendary ship, The Titanic, Forbes reported.

Named, Titanic II, will carry passengers in "style and luxury" around the world. Palmer, who started the project twice before, has stated that this time it’s really going to happen.

According to the plans, his shipping company Blue Star Lines, will recreate the exact replica of Titanic, including the grand staircase, a smoking room, casino, theatre and a dining room which will serve food similar to that of the original one.

The construction for the ship will begin next year, and is scheduled to be finished by 2027. It will make its first voyage in June 2027.

As per the 3D plans, the ship will have 835 cabins, out of which, 383 will be first class, 201 second class and 251 third-class rooms.

The ship will reportedly accommodate 2,345 passengers, who will be encouraged to dress as in the early 1900s.

The ticket prices for Titanic II have not yet been announced.

According to the Guardian, the construction of the ship will cost around $500 million to $1 billion.

Palmer, 69, is the 73rd richest man in the and 13th richest in Australia. According to Forbes, his net worth is estimated to be $4.3 billion.

He served as a minster in the Australian parliament from 2013 to 2016. He owns several mining companies and shipping company Blue Star lines.
